Proteomics moves from expression to turnover: update and future perspective

Abstract

Proteomics is a rapidly developing discipline that seeks to understand the role of proteins in the wider biological context. In order to take a holistic view of a biological system, it is vital that we can elucidate the dynamics of the proteome. In this article, we have outlined the recent advances in experimental strategies for measuring protein synthesis and degradation on a proteome-wide scale. The application of mass spectrometry and non-mass spectrometric-based approaches in this field of research has been discussed. The article also explores the challenges associated with these types of analyses and the development of appropriate bioinformatic resources for interrogating the complex datasets that are generated.
